Self-sampling and self-testing for HIV at a commercial and community-based test provider in the Netherlands: user preferences and usability

Willemstein et al.

The finding, in our words

Among 133 users of HIV self-sampling and self-testing in the Netherlands, the commonest reason for choosing this route was saving time, followed by anonymity and avoiding a GP visit. However, 22% encountered problems, with seven in ten of those struggling to obtain enough blood from a finger prick, showing that while self-testing expands reach, blood collection remains a key usability hurdle for decentralised HIV screening.

    The Tasso+ device, which uses a vacuum to collect capillary blood from the upper arm, gathered an average of 536 microlitres of whole blood from 47 men who have sex with men using PrEP, with 91% of samples sufficient for HIV testing and 89% for syphilis testing. Acceptability was high, with 87% expressing a positive attitude and 77% willing to use the device again for home self-sampling.

    The Tasso OnDemand device was well accepted by participants, with nearly all finding it easy to use and feeling confident they could self-sample at home, and paired self-collected and clinician-collected specimens showed high agreement for HIV, syphilis and creatinine tests. While most users collected enough serum for two monitoring tests, only a third produced sufficient volume for three tests, suggesting a larger-volume device may be preferable for full guideline-recommended PrEP monitoring.

    In a cohort of 62 participants evaluating home self-collection with the TassoPlus device, 38 returned samples, with 29% excluded due to insufficient plasma volume below 200 ΔL. Although viral load measurements in adequate samples correlated well with conventional testing (r = 0.800), the high failure rate and missed detection in low-volume viremic samples indicate that further technical refinements are necessary before clinical adoption.

    In a feasibility randomised controlled trial with 28 adults aged 65 years, 62% successfully self-collected finger-prick capillary blood samples for influenza antibody and vitamin D measurement. While overall study procedures were acceptable, the capillary sampling method requires refinement before wider deployment in decentralised diagnostics for older adults.

    A UK survey of 2,816 healthcare workers found that 74% preferred at-home PCR testing and 52% preferred at-home serological sampling over hospital visits; some reported blood-collection or kit difficulties, and the authors conclude that home sampling is acceptable and workable for keeping participants in long-running studies.
